site stats

React native split bundle

WebSep 9, 2024 · The base bundle contains dependencies like react-native, which host uses. So in the host bundle need to call a native function to synchronously load and evaluate base bundle. We figured out there are 2 viable ways to achieve that: WebHow to use the react-native-device-info.getDeviceLocale function in react-native-device-info To help you get started, we’ve selected a few react-native-device-info examples, based on popular ways it is used in public projects.

Loading multiple bundles in react-native Code splitting using Metro

WebSep 14, 2024 · To avoid this kind of issue, we need to structure our components in an optimized way. To solve this react itself has a native solution, which is code-splitting and lazy loading. Which allows splitting bundle files into a smaller size. The best place to introduce code splitting is in routes. Route-based code-splitting solve half of the issues. how many kids does yadier molina have https://redroomunderground.com

react native --how to split react native

WebNov 10, 2024 · Again, the sample project is the key, look at the sample app’s build.gradle file.. Notice the config section: /** * The react.gradle file registers a task for each build variant (e.g. bundleDebugJsAndAssets * and bundleReleaseJsAndAssets). * These basically call `react-native bundle` with the correct arguments during the Android build * cycle. By … WebRN Bundle split is not just "split", it should also take two point into consideration: How to use them, means native code framework change, because RN native part not support loading script in demand. Project structure, you should have a clean project dependency graph (recursive dependency is bad). WebWhen working with React, managing state is a crucial aspect of creating dynamic and interactive user interfaces. The useState and useReducer hooks are both… Mahdi Ta'ala على LinkedIn: Making the Right Choice: When to Use useState or useReducer in React how many kids does will smith have with jada

How to generate Android app bundle in React Native?

Category:Code splitting with React.lazy and Suspense

Tags:React native split bundle

React native split bundle

desmond1121/react-native-split: React Native Bundle Splitter - Github

WebBundle splitting is a complementary technique that lets you define splitting behavior on the level of configuration. A common use case is extracting so called vendor bundle that contains third-party dependencies. The split allows the client to download only the application bundle if there are changes only in the application code. WebOct 1, 2024 · Step 3 — Lazy Loading a Component with Suspense and lazy. In this step, you’ll split your code with React Suspense and lazy. As applications grow, the size of the final build grows with it. Rather than forcing users to download the whole application, you can split the code into smaller chunks.

React native split bundle

Did you know?

WebDecrease your start up time and RAM memory consumption by an application via splitting JS bundle by components and navigation routes. Latest version: 2.2.3, last published: 6 … WebRead about code splitting in react-router/web. For example: function atRuntime () { import ('lodash').then ( () => {});} This will import the library at runtime with an ajax request so it is not bundled in the main.js. I'd like to recycle my code between web and native and we use a lot of code splitting for each page change.

WebJun 10, 2024 · react-native-multiple-bundle A naive approach towards code splitting and loading multiple JS bundles in react-native Objective Consider a scenario where an app … WebIt's time to put together an rnx-bundle command for your app. Start with react-native rnx-bundle, and add the parameters listed in this table: Add --dev false if you want to make an optimized, production bundle. Put it all together into a single command. Here's an example which creates an iOS developer bundle: react-native rnx-bundle \

WebApr 14, 2024 · to create main js Bundle react-native bundle --platform android --dev false --entry-file index.js --bundle-output android/app/src/main/assets/index.android.bundle --assets-dest android/app/src/main/res/ and then run cd android && ./gradlew assembleRelease Share Improve this answer Follow answered Apr 14, 2024 at 4:20 … WebApr 29, 2024 · However, there will always be a slight delay that users have to experience when a code-split component is being fetched over the network, so it's important to display a useful loading state. Using React.lazy with the Suspense component helps solve this problem. import React, { lazy, Suspense } from 'react'; const AvatarComponent = lazy ...

WebJan 22, 2016 · To help you get started, we’ve selected a few react-native-fs exam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here.

WebTo help you get started, we’ve selected a few react-native-device-info exam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. const preventNoise = (): void => { /* Sentry should not normally be used in debug mode. how many kids does wendy williams haveWebGetting started with React code splitting In this example, we'll perform lazy loading both with and without React Suspense. Step 1: Create a React application using the command - … how many kids does yammy haveWebDec 7, 2024 · Code splitting using Webpack dynamic import syntax. Check out the example below: import (“module_name”).then ( { default } => // do something) This syntax will let the Webpack file that's to be code split and bundled be generated accordingly. There are also other ways in Webpack like using manual entry points and SplitChunksPlugin. howard schare dmdWebRN Bundle split is not just "split", it should also take two point into consideration: How to use them, means native code framework change, because RN native part not support loading … howard schafer artistWebSep 10, 2015 · 1 Answer. If you can verify it's already minified there's no straightforward way to make it smaller but I believe the team behind the React Native Packager is planning a … howard schain propertiesWebreact-native: 0.55.0 Steps to reproduce When running the bundle, following error occurrs: bundling failed: Error: Unable to resolve module util from D:\\project\node_modules\@splitsoftware\splitio\lib\utils\logger\LoggerFactory.js: Module util does not exist in the Haste module map Answer howards chapel baptist churchWeb@rnx-kit/react-native-host simplifies React Native initialization. The aim of this package is to provide a backwards (and forwards) compatible way of initializing React Native, regardless of whether you're on New Architecture or have gone fully bridgeless. @rnx-kit/react-native-host will also a provide a simple way to enable split bundles and ... howardscenicsupplies.co.uk